AI-Generated Summary

David Hoffmeister shares a profound journey of spiritual awakening through A Course in Miracles (ACIM), a text he describes as a divine scripture not from human origin but from direct divine transmission. He recounts transformative experiences where the veil of reality lifted, revealing a timeless, formless light—experiences he calls revelatory glimpses of oneness. Central to ACIM’s teaching is the radical idea that the physical world is an illusion, a projection of the ego’s split mind, not created by God but by a 'tiny mad idea' that forgot to laugh. Time and space are temporary constructs, and reality is pure, eternal oneness. David explains that forgiveness in ACIM is not about excusing others’ actions but releasing grievances rooted in our own beliefs—forgiving our brother for what they have not done. This shift in perception leads to a life of devotion, intuition, and miracles, where guidance comes not from analysis but from inner alignment with the Holy Spirit. He details how he left a prestigious academic career at 34 to live a life of radical trust, supported by miraculous provisions, and co-founded a community based on shared property, no secrets, and prayer-based decision-making. The conversation explores how symbols like community, movies, and even the body are tools to transcend illusion, not ends in themselves. Ultimately, David emphasizes that the path is one of surrender, presence, and inner transformation—where the mind’s power to create reality is both the source of suffering and the key to liberation.
